Original acrylic painting, 11x14. Framed.
Summer of 2021 was weird in Wynnewood. It was the first summer in like 50 years that the pool never opened. I'm not sure why, although I have this vague memory of hearing the phrase "staffing issues." Usually at night it was dark and practically invisible, but this particular evening they'd left all the lights one. So me being me, I pulled into the parking lot like a weirdo and took lots of photos.
I'd like to thank the moon for shining so bright that night.
